One paper, a review of the state of the art of augmented mobile platforms and uses in museums and collections and I find a treasure trove of examples – quite a few links failed, but a little detective work and I found links to some of the wonderous Apps that are available for museum and gallery visitors even in this case from the Wellcome Foundation, an augmented ‘City Walk’ from the Medical History of London. I believe creating content for platforms such as these is straightforward too, so putting the creation process into the hands of curators and visitors, rather than external agencies.
